Can you change when things are marked "Watched"

Normally, it’s pretty spot on. I watch a movie or show, and it will be marked Watched right about when the credits start rolling…

But, I’ve started listening to audiobooks via plex. that 90% point where Plex decides I’m done with a file comes a lot further from the end in an 18 hour book. Likewise, it’s incredibly hard to use the slider to find where I left off when each the slightest movement is equal to 45 minutes. If I could change the limit, whether per library, or even just over all, it would be great.
